Overview
Cedar Bonsai (Cedrus species) is a majestic evergreen conifer with short needles, strong trunks and sweeping old-tree form. It is best suited to informal upright, literati, windswept and dramatic old conifer designs. For UK growers, treat it as: Outdoor only.
Placement
full sun and excellent airflow
Watering
water thoroughly when the surface begins to dry; avoid waterlogged soil
Feeding and fertilising
feed moderately during spring and early summer
Pruning and wiring
pinch or cut new growth carefully; avoid hard cuts into bare old wood
Repotting
repot every 3-5 years in spring with conservative root work
Propagation
seed, grafting or nursery material
Pests, diseases and common issues
needle drop from stress, spider mites, root disturbance and dieback after severe pruning
